How old should my puppy be to leave crate for a puppy-proof room?

Updated On September 23rd, 2025

Pet's info: Dog | Miniature Poodle | Male | neutered | 3 months and 6 days old | 15 lbs

When should/could we transition our puppy from a crate to a puppy proof room when we’re not home?

You can do this any time. Leave the crate open in the room, where he is to spend his time, so he can go into it at any time and feel safe. Realize that your puppy still cannot hold its urine for a very long time yet, so I would not leave him alone for more than 4 hours.
